The way Licensing Protects Your Private and Monetary Data
Preserving your personal information protected is a key issue when you gamble online. A genuine casino license forces a platform to manage your data correctly. Licensed casinos have to use robust security measures, particularly high-grade Secure Socket Layer (SSL) encryption. This technology jumbles all you transmit, like your ID or bank details, so third parties are unable to read it. Regulators also enforce data protection rules like laws like the GDPR. This stops the casino from sharing or exploiting your information. On the money side, licenses often require that player funds go into segregated accounts. This indicates your deposits are maintained distinct from the company’s own operating cash. Your money remains protected and ready for your withdrawals, even if the business faces trouble. This tiered protection, mandated by the license, is what enables you sign up and play with more confidence.
Fair Play Assurances: The Function of RNG Certification
A balanced game relies on one element: chance outcomes. Licensing is directly linked to this assurance. A regulated casino must source its games from suppliers whose Random Number Generator (RNG) platforms are verified regularly. External labs like eCOGRA, iTech Labs, and GLI conduct this verification. They confirm that the RNG generates data that are fully arbitrary and unforeseeable for every single game round. Handling Disputes: A Player’s Path to Recourse
Occasionally things go wrong. A bonus may not appear, or a withdrawal may be held up. At an unlicensed casino, you’re forced to debate with the site itself, which frequently yields no result. A licensed casino reverses the situation. The regulator gives you a formal way to escalate the problem. Your first move involves contacting the casino’s support with all the details. If they can’t settle it justly, your next step involves filing a complaint with the licensing authority. Groups like the MGA have official dispute teams. They’ll look into your case based on the casino’s own terms and the regulator’s rulebook. This oversight makes the casino act openly, because it knows it can be held responsible. For any player, that external option represents a powerful safety net.

Responsible Gambling: A Regulatory Requirement
You can tell a lot by how a casino approaches responsible gambling. For a licensed operator, it’s not an optional extra. It’s a requirement. As I see it, this is one of the most important protections a license offers you. Regulators require these platforms to offer you real tools to regulate your play. You ought to expect to find:
- Deposit Caps: Set a cap on how much you can deposit to your account each day, week, or month.
- Loss Caps: Set the maximum amount you’re okay with losing in a set period.
- Session Timers: Receive notifications that inform you how long you’ve been playing.
- Self-Exclusion: Temporarily or permanently close your account.
- Reality Checks: Alerts that display your play time and spending for the session.
Licensed casinos also must refer to professional help groups like GamCare or the Canadian Centre on Substance Use and Addiction. This systematic support, required by the regulator, indicates that player safety is a core priority.
Understanding Regulatory Bodies for Canadian Players
Canada’s regulatory picture is a bit of a hodgepodge. We lack one national online gambling regulator. Instead, provinces like Ontario, British Columbia, and Quebec manage their own official sites. Many international casinos that welcome Canadian players, Bonuskong included, possess licenses from respected offshore authorities. The big names here are the Malta Gaming Authority (MGA) and the Curacao eGaming Licensing Authority. The MGA has a name for being strict, with tough rules for player protection, game fairness, and financial crime prevention. A Curacao license also delivers a legal framework, though its standards can vary. The key point is this: any legitimate license means the casino reports to an outside authority and gets audited. That is always safer than playing somewhere with no license at all.
